About Lightning Protection
Lightning protection systems include air terminals (rods), conductors, grounding systems, and surge protection. Costs vary based on materials, installation complexity, and compliance with local regulations (IEC 62305, NFPA 780).

Lightning Protection Formula
Total Cost = (Base Cost × Area × Height Factor × Risk Factor × Protection Level × Material Factor × Region Factor) + Installation
Base cost is typically $15-30 per m² depending on complexity. Installation is usually 40-60% of material cost. All calculations follow IEC 62305 standards for lightning protection.
